I want to try getting some different things with my snack credits instead of the usual popcorn, pretzel, ice cream bar...

What do you dining planners LOVE to use your snack credits for?
 
I haven't gotten one yet, but I've heard good things about the baked potato from the Liberty Square Market in the Magic Kingdom. Sometimes they also have baked sweet potatoes abailable.
 
I've used snack credits for olive tapenade and bagel chips to spread it on at both Pop's food court and the Mara at AKL and crepes in France in Epcot.
 

My all time favorite snack is to snack our way through the countries for lunch. Favs are to go to France and the four of us split a couple of ham and cheese croissants and a Napolean YUM! Then we go to germany for brats and pretzels and finish by going to karamell kuche. Last time we had a caramel cupcake there but this year I have my eye on a dark chocolate caramel with sea salt.

I used snack credits mostly for breakfast...usually a yogurt parfait at our resort (CSR) which was so filling.

I do remember at Hollywood Studios right by the Aerosmith rollercoaster there is a stand that had yogurt smoothies for a snack credit. Both flavors were really good (but very sweet) and pretty large. We had a hard time finishing them. It's not really a "different" snack, but a great value and not total junk food. :)

Food and Wine Fest. - Lobster roll, but have to try the "Le Cellier" Wild Mushroom Beef Filet Mignon with Truffle Butter Sauce at the Canada kiosk
EPCOT-Sweet almond pretzel at Kringla or anything at France bakery
Animal Kingdom-Jalapeno Cheese Stuffed Pretzel
DHS- cupcake at Staring Rools
MK-Warm Cinammon Roll Main st bakery or Dole Whip Pineapple Float
POP- hot fudge sundae or blueberry muffin or cinammon bun
